原创 四.docker容器管理

試驗機192.168.181.144 用戶root 密碼123456 主機名root@web:/# hostnameweb docker container run -d --name web2 -P nginx #-P :發佈容器中聲明

原创 dockerfile指令說明

Copy:將workdir裏的文件複製到鏡像中。WORKDIR /appCOPY nickdir . Add:除了copy所有功能,add可以將壓縮文件,解壓縮然後直接複製到鏡像中。如:WORKDIR /appADD nickdir.tar

原创 塊存儲、文件存儲、對象存儲意義及差異

關於塊存儲、文件存儲、對象存儲方面的知識在知乎上看到了個很好的解答:https://www.zhihu.com/question/21536660 通俗易懂,查了些資料做了詳細的補充。 塊存儲 典型設備:磁盤陣列、硬盤 塊存儲主要是將裸磁盤

原创 QEMU,KVM及QEMU-KVM介紹

What's QEMUQEMU是一個主機上的VMM(virtual machine monitor),通過動態二進制轉換來模擬CPU,並提供一系列的硬件模型,使guest os認爲自己和硬件直接打交道,其實是同QEMU模擬出來的硬件打交道,

原创 完全備份,差異備份,增量備份

1、完全備份(Full Backup)備份全部選中的文件夾,並不依賴文件的存檔屬性來確定備份那些文件。在備份過程中,任何現有的標記都被清除,每個文件都被標記爲已備份。換言之,清除存檔屬性。完全備份就是指對某一個時間點上的所有數據或應用進行的

原创 完全備份,差異備份,增量備份

1、完全備份(Full Backup)備份全部選中的文件夾,並不依賴文件的存檔屬性來確定備份那些文件。在備份過程中,任何現有的標記都被清除,每個文件都被標記爲已備份。換言之,清除存檔屬性。完全備份就是指對某一個時間點上的所有數據或應用進行的

原创 災備建設的兩個指標RTO和RPO

數據備份最重要的目的就是“恢復數據”。當系統出現故障損毀時,可以通過數據備份來恢復,最大限度降低損失。         但是,系統需要進行什麼程度的備份,這就需要根據實際情況來制定。這裏,有兩個指標可以參考: RTO:Recovery Ti

原创 MySQL數據庫遷移詳細步驟

https://blog.51cto.com/sofar/1598364

原创 memcached分佈式緩存

分佈式緩存出於如下考慮,首先是緩存本身的水平線性擴展問題,其次是緩存大併發下的本身的性能問題,再次避免緩存的單點故障問題(多副本和副本一致性)。分佈式緩存的核心技術包括首先是內存本身的管理問題,包括了內存的分配,管理和回收機制。其次是分佈式

原创 爲什麼要使用 Docker

首先說下 Docker 的主要目標就是實現輕量級的操作系統虛擬化解決方案。Dokcer的基礎是Linux容器(LXC)等技術。Docker和傳統虛擬化方式的不同之處,就是容器是在操作系統層面上實現虛擬化,直接複用本地操作系統,而傳統方式則是

原创 LVS負載均衡

模型一:NAT模型的配置實驗環境:採用VMware虛擬機,版本6.0.5操作系統:Red Hat Enterprise Linux 5 (2.6.18)虛擬機1:充當Director:網卡1(橋接):192.168.0.33(對外),網卡2

原创 python環境配置

Python 環境搭建本章節我們將向大家介紹如何在本地搭建Python開發環境。Python可應用於多平臺包括 Linux 和 Mac OS X。你可以通過終端窗口輸入 "python" 命令來查看本地是否已經安裝Python以及Pytho

原创 我的友情鏈接

51CTO博客開發明誠閣晨溪@#小T#@lgzengMVP - Torrent的博客滴水穿石王春海的博客貓熊的幸福生活Linux系統架構代光的博客linuxCitrix自由人信息港技術成就夢想ccfxny的博客pmghong小棟—HOME吟

原创 TCP長連接與短連接的區別

1. TCP連接當網絡通信時採用TCP協議時,在真正的讀寫操作之前,server與client之間必須建立一個連接,當讀寫操作完成後,雙方不再需要這個連接時它們可以釋放這個連接,連接的建立是需要三次握手的,而釋放則需要4次握手,所以說每個連

原创 docker同宿主機容器和不同宿主機容器之間怎麼通信?

第一部分 docker有四種網絡模式第一種:bridge 模式當docker進程啓動時,主機上會創建一個名爲docker0的虛擬網橋,容器內部會創建一個只能容器內部看到的接口eth0,eth0 和docker0工作方式就像物理二層交換機一樣